The value of the number 9 representing Kari's mass depends on the digits' place in the number. If it's in the 'tens' place (as in 95), its value is 90; if it's in the 'ones' place (as in 19), its value is 9.
To determine the value of the number that represents Kari's mass, please provide the full number. The exact value of 9 in this number will depend on its placement. For instance, if Kari's mass is 95 kilograms, the value of 9 is 90 because it occupies the 'tens' place. However, if her mass would be 19 kilograms, the value of 9 would be 9 because it is in the 'ones' place. To know the value of digit, understanding the positions of numbers in place value is important.
